About this map

The San Juan River carves a deep path through the high desert of the Four Corners region, defining the complex intersection of the Colorado-New Mexico state line and the borders of the Ute Mountain Indian Reservation and Navajo Indian Reservation. This 1980s landscape is largely defined by its drainage systems, including the Mancos River and several prominent washes such as Salt Wash, Game Wash, and Beclabito Wash that feed into the main river channel.
